Ashley Stewart

Explore Sand Silt and Clay - National Wildlife Federation - 1 views

    • Ashley Stewart
       
      1.2.1 "Observe and compare properties of sand, clay, silt and organic matter. Look for evidence of sand, clay, silt and organic matter as components of soil samples." This activity can be modified for gifted students by having them record their predictions about which particles will sink and which particles will float, rather than solely making the observations. This activity can also be modified for older grades by having them do the same thing. The older students can also be told to gather material that is sand, silt, and clay, and try to keep these in separate jars. 
  •  
    Students gather dirt samples from different outdoor areas and fill a jar with their dirt samples. The teacher will add water until the jar is two-thirds full and the students will take turns shaking their jar for two minutes. Each group will allow the contents in their jar to settle for fifteen to thirty minutes. Have the students make observations about how the dirt settled. The heaviest pieces of soil will settle first. Have the students identify the different-sized particles.
